A walk-in shower is a wonderful option to include in your next bathroom remodel. Consider these benefits when deciding whether to remove an old tub and shower combination from your new bathroom design.

Always Warm - Say goodbye to shivering while waiting for the water to warm up. With a walk-in shower, you can turn it on when you're ready to step in, ensuring that the water is just the right temperature.

Safety First -Walk-in showers provide a safer option for those who rely on a walker or a wheelchair to get around. The open and easy-to-access design makes it simple to get in and out, making it a great option for families with small children, elderly individuals, and those with disabilities.

Stay Hygienic - Enjoy a more thorough clean by sitting comfortably on your shower bench while the water covers your entire body. The walk-in design allows for better rinsing and reduces the risk of mold and mildew buildup.

Eco-Friendly - According to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, taking a shower uses 10 to 25 gallons of water, compared to taking a bath which can use up to 70 gallons. Opt for a walk-in shower to conserve water and reduce your carbon footprint.

Built to Last - A walk-in shower has fewer parts than a traditional bathtub or shower, which means there are fewer components that could break. With proper maintenance, a walk-in shower can last longer than your current bathroom setup.

Memory Loss Friendly - For those with cognitive challenges and memory loss, changes in water temperature and pressure can make bathing difficult. A walk-in shower, with its open and easy-to-access design, can provide a safer and more comfortable option for those in cognitive decline.
